Abstract
- We demonstrate a tandem truncation-functionalization strategy using the 3D covalent organic framework, COF-102. Allyl groups incorporated within the pore walls were subjected to thiol-ene coupling conditions, achieving high conversions and maintaining the crystallinity and permanent porosity of the parent framework.
